Jørn H. Winther

Jorn Winther was an award-winning producer/director/writer with more than five decades of experience collaborating with the world's most distinguished talent. Mr. Winther's breadth of work included MOW, drama, variety, comedy, specials, news, sports, documentaries, videos, game shows and commercials. Among his career highlights, Mr. Winther mounted the iconic news program 20/20, produced and/or directed Shindig!, The Jonathan Winters Show, The Barbara McNair Show, All My Children, Santa Barbara, and David Frost Interviews Richard Nixon.

Mr. Winther's experience involved every facet of the news production and entertainment process. He created and sold programs, wrote and edited dramatic scripts, created story lines, headed story meetings with writers and was creatively responsible for the final product. He was one of the few directors in U.S. whose theatrical background enabled him to communicate with actors; his people skills were demonstrated by the variety of entertainers and celebrities he directed. As a producer/director, he was responsible for more than 1,000 hours of prime time television, more than 300 dramatic hours in daytime television, and numerous stage plays.

His shows collected 37 Emmy nominations and won 12. He was also co-founder of the successful creative script service, Script Daddy.
